Co-Extrusion: Merging Materials for Enhanced Functionality

Have you ever thought about how manufacturing can be transformed? Well, co-extrusion technology is doing just that! It allows for the simultaneous extrusion of multiple substances, which means products can have enhanced properties. Take Lincoln Plastics, for example. They effectively use co-extrusion to combine materials that offer both durability and flexibility, resulting in strong products that are perfect for a variety of applications.

Now, let’s talk about why this matters. In critical sectors like automotive and construction, material performance is key. In the automotive industry, co-extrusion can enhance components by integrating weather-resistant layers. This not only improves longevity but also boosts performance under extreme conditions. Pretty cool, right?

And it doesn’t stop there! In construction, co-extruded shapes can include features like thermal insulation and aesthetic finishes - all in one go. This optimizes production and helps lower expenses. As more manufacturers jump on the co-extrusion bandwagon, they’re seeing benefits like improved product functionality, reduced lead times, and the ability to meet changing market demands efficiently.

Polyethylene and PVC: Versatile Materials in Extrusion

In the extrusion industry, examples of extrusion include polyethylene and PVC, which are both heavyweights with their unique traits suited for various applications. Take polyethylene, for instance. It's super flexible and moisture-resistant, which makes it perfect for things like irrigation pipes and adaptable structures. In farming, polyethylene irrigation systems really boost water efficiency and crop yields. Pretty neat, right?

Now, let’s talk about Lincoln Plastics. They whip up a variety of flexible shapes using advanced co-extrusion techniques, mixing in multiple colors to make their products not just functional but also visually appealing. On the flip side, examples of extrusion that utilize PVC are the go-to for those who need something rigid and durable. It’s the top choice for structural applications like piping and construction components.
